Awhile back I did a fairly rough estimate of the economics of independant SP vs. agency SP and though it is far to detailed to get into here there is are some definite points in which girls have to be doing business in order to be profitable.

Agency ladies are basically independant contractors so working at an agency they are sharing overhead with other contractors, this reduces several basic expenses and often frees up many hours of admin. time so in theory they may make more per hour by subcontracting out any nonclient related issues. Some ladies like myself and Gen for example work for an agency but choose to spend non-billable hours interacting with our clients online, this may or may not reduce our ROI, as some might argue it could also increase it by being hands on with marketing and brand.

In contrast independants are required to handle all aspects of their business themselves, however many are too busy with the day to day administrative duties such as fielding basic inquiries, paying invoices, etc. to even consider brand management. I don't want to get into too many specifics here as I don't want to single out any of the girls that over the years were kind enough to talk to me about their business but there appears to be a way to be profitable at the very high client volume and very low client volume but not much in the middle as an independant. An agency girl on the otherhand has much more flexibility in her profit model and can generally be profitable at all levels if she chooses.

It might also be easier to be an indy if this is your only job, but for someone in school or with another job, it would be almost impossible IMO because of the time consumption answering emails and calls, most of which are dead ends.
I started as a student and would answer my phone when I got home from school each day.. most clients booked with 1/2 hr notice for a 1/2 hr incall. Easy Peezy..

re: independant vs. agency. I have been independant for 19 of my 20 years escorting.. as soon as I realized I didn't need an agency.. I stopped using one. Back then I needed to pay for advertising in the paper (Now Magazine was the only way and then Eye weekly followed suit..eventually the Sun).

Prior to that the yellow pages were the only way to go and agencies were the norm.. I also added identi-call so I had a 2nd # with a separate ring. Keeping in mind this was before cell phone use. Now being an indy is virtually painfree with respect to cost. Internet advertising is very cost effective compared to the paper ads and email cost effective compared to the phone.

The main reason for an agency was/would be for me.. if I only wanted to do outcalls. But as a student I managed to get 3 other girlfriends interested in the idea of doing incalls back in the 80's and away we went..

Personally I found with respect to loser factor/risk factor I had better results when I answered the phone myself than when I worked for an agency... but not all agency owners are as interested in the quick buck and as disinterested in the escort's emotional/physical health as mine was. She really lost out b/c I wouldn't have gone indy had she taken better care of me.
